$40,000 center channel speaker is made of glass, gold, and wishes

Nothing says luxury like gold and glass. Or, rather, nothing makes something look luxurious like a healthy sampling of those two materials. I assume that's where Perfect8 gets off charging $40,000 for a single center-channel speaker made of mostly glass and gold.
The Force center speaker was designed to compliment Focus8's equally ludicrous Force loudspeakers (which cost $277,000) and is adjustable depending on where you want the speaker to aim. Inside, you'll find two modified 7-inch MG-cone drivers, a pair of modified 5.25-inch MG-cone drivers and a 1-inch silk-dome tweeter with a meticulous wave guide. So shiny! So worth it!
